Tattooing, pregnancy, and breastfeeding

We do not tattoo pregnant women.
A tattoo is a breach in the skin. It causes trauma to the body (even if it doesn't actually hurt), This causes stress which can then have consequences for the fetus.

You can tattoo a breastfeeding woman, BUT…
Tattoo ink remains in the dermis of the skin. There is no reason for it to end up in breast milk.
BUT tattoos can be a source of stress, which can then have consequences on breastfeeding (inflammation, insufficient milk, milk stasis…).
ALWAYS CONSULT YOUR DOCTOR if you choose to breastfeed and get a tattoo!
